After that, we broke down the Atlantic Division standings. Incredibly – considering the turbulence lately – the Leafs still find themselves just two points behind the Panthers. Most importantly, they still have two games left against them. It’s right there for them —that’s for sure.
Then, we got into a full game recap from Saturday night in Nashville. Toronto built up an early 2-0 lead. Additionally, for a short time, it was actually 3-0, but the goal was called back due to a Scott Laughton hi-stick. You can call that the Jay Rosehill Turning Point of the game. Because after that, it was all Predators as Andrew Brunette’s squad riled off five unanswered goals. Toronto lost 5-2. Auston Matthews had two apples and Mitch Marner notched a goal and an assist. As John Tavares put it post-game, they should be pissed off about how things went. Speaking of which, we got into the Scott Laughton conversation. In eight outings as a Leaf, the former Flyer has really struggled. He’s yet to register a point playing in predominantly a fourth line role.
